Page 1421 - Informatica dalla A a Z
P. 1421

String messaggio = "Dati inseriti: ” + cogno-

              meLetto +
                                      " " + nomeLetto;
                                      JOptionPane.showMessageDialog( this, messaggio,
                                      "Conferma ", DOptionPane.INFORMATION_MESSAGE );
                               }
                          }
                 }
              }

                                                           AJAX




           AJAX (Asinchronous JavaScript And XML) non è un linguaggio di programmazione, ma una
           tecnica di sviluppo del software che utilizza JavaScript. Con questo linguaggio si cerca di
           migliorare al massimo la velocità di risposta del server Web quando viene compilato un
           modulo in Internet.


           Le applicazioni Ajax sono in grado di ottenere dal web server, solo i dati necessari, ren-
           dendo così, le applicazioni più veloci, in quanto la quantità di dati scambiati fra il browser
           ed il server si riduce e il tempo di elaborazione da parte del web server diminuisce.





                                                     Il linguaggio XML




           Il linguaggio XML (eXtensible Markup Language), è un metalinguaggio per definire nuovi
           linguaggi basati su tag, che sta diventando sempre più popolare come metodo di conser-
           vazione dei dati. Esso rappresenta i dati marcandoli con dei “tag”, in maniera molto simile

           all’HTML, e per questo è molto adatto alla conservazione e alla ricerca dei dati.

           I punti chiave di XML sono i seguenti:

            • Separazione del contenuto dalla rappresentazione dei dati: un documento XML defini-
            sce la struttura dei dati e non contiene alcun dettaglio relativo alla loro formattazione o

            a un qualsiasi utilizzo.

            • Definizione di un formato standard: XML è uno standard del W3C e quindi un docu-
            mento XML può essere elaborato da qualsiasi parser o tool conforme allo standard.


           affinché sia visualizzabile da un browser, un documento XML deve rispettare ben precise
           regole strutturali; in particolare:

            • ogni tag aperto deve essere chiuso;


            • i tag non devono essere sovrapposti;
                                                           1417
   1416   1417   1418   1419   1420   1421   1422   1423   1424   1425   1426